      Before they will even consider your job, you have to pay $300. This is to get them to go look at the site and provide a bid. I paid that and it took me a few months to get the money together to get the work done. I understand that after a certain amount of time, the circumstances might have changed, but refusing to go back out and verify that without another payment is absurd. Once I told them that I was ready to go, I had to wait another month before they finally told me that it would cost me another $100 to get them out there to verify the original bid, and they had no documentation of the bid other than some scribbled notes from the first visit.

      Go elsewhere. These folks aren't worth your time or money.

      Do not use Butler Contracting. We have been waiting months to get a bid for our insurance company for damage from the freeze in February. They charged us $270 twice to come out and assess our situation before they would provide a bid... told us the last time as he was leaving that we would have the bid by the end of the week... that was May!! Understanding that they are busy we tried to be patient, but stayed in touch and were told over and over that the bid was coming... they strung us along for months!!! Then last week they told us that we would not get a bid from them because they are too busy, yet they also refused to refund our money. They said our home is too custom... it is just as custom as it was the first time they were here in March... not any more custom when they came back in May.... yet they waited until late August to decide they are too busy!! Yet, here they are trying to drum up more new business instead of finishing what they have already been paid to do!!! Again... Do not do business with them. They will take your money and make promises with no follow through. I have lodged a complaint with BBB and FTC as well and spoken to my attorney to explore our rights... It seems that because this contractor fraud is in relation to a natural disaster recovery this is taken very seriously by the Federal Trade Commission. They may not be in business much longer... ‍
